On the Discovery page, columns in the table list details for each available Schedule manager, representing a discovery. You can click a column to sort the list by that attribute. You can also specify which details are included in the list.
Available columns include:
-
ID: The Schedule manager ID.
-
Cloud: The infrastructure platform that the job explores.
This can be Amazon Web Services, Google Cloud Platform, or Microsoft Azure.
-
Resource types: The type of resources that the jobs will search for
-
Status: The status of the Discovery job (such as whether it is Started or Stopped).
- URL: The URL or IP address of the network you are discovering.
-
Job time started: The starting time of the most recent execution for this job.
-
Job time completed: The ending time of the most recent execution for this job.
-
Interval: The number of seconds to wait between repeated executions of this job. If None, then the job is only run once.
-
Username: The Address Manager user name under which CDV imported these resources.
-
Configuration: The Address Manager Configuration in which these resources are imported.
- Organization: If true, the Schedule Manager will perform Organization-level discovery.
-
The following columns apply only to Amazon Web Services infrastructures:
-
AWS regions: The AWS region names.
-
AWS account: The AWS account number.
-
AWS user: AWS role ARN.
-
-
The following columns apply only to Google Cloud Platform jobs:
- GCP email: The email associated with the GCP service account credentials.
- Project ID: The GCP Project ID.
-
The following columns apply only to Microsoft Azure jobs:
-
Tenant ID: The Azure Tenant ID.
-
Subscription: The Azure Subscription ID.
-
Resource group: The Azure Resource Group name.
